Abstract

1286439 Vehicle seats RECARD A G 28 Nov 1969 [31 Jan 1969] 3184/72 Divided out of 1285360 Heading A4J [Also in Division F2] A vehicle seat 301 which is connected to a base by a front supporting leg 304 pivotally connected the base and the seat, is provided with a seat belt, one end of which is attached to the back of the seat and an energy dissipating means 308 which absorbs energy when the seat is moved by the weight of the occupant against the seat belt on sudden acceleration or deceleration of the vehicle. The height of the seat may be adjusted by altering the length of rod 307. In a second embodiment, Fig.2 (not shown) a rear leg (315) which is rigid with the seat has its lower end slidably mounted in an upwardly and forwardly inclined slot (320) in a bracket secured to the base (316) and the energy dissipating means (318) is connected between the lower ends of the front and rear legs. In a modification of the second embodiment, Figs.3-4 (not shown) a further supporting leg (331) with a slot (332) therein is connected between the centre of the seat part and the lower end of the rear leg (325), the energy dissipating means (328) being connected between the lower end of the front leg (324) and the slot in the further leg (331). A hook (333) is provided to hold the energy dissipating means in the upper end of the slot in the normal position of the seat and to release the energy dissipating means so that the seat may be tilted forwardly for access to the space behind the seat. In a second modification of the second embodiment, Figs.6-8 (not shown), the slot in which the rear leg is slidable is curved upwardly at the front end thereof, to tilt the seat backwards as it moves forwards, and the seat is held in its normal position by a stop projection (354) on the seat frame (342) resting on the front of the front leg and the front leg (344) is prevented from pivoting forwardly by a shearing pin (355) which forms the energy dissipating means. After this pin is sheared a further stop pin (356) comes into effect; both pins can be withdrawn laterally of the seat to allow it to be moved freely when desired. The shearing pin may be supplemented by other energy dissipating means such as a friction brake at one or each of the pivots of each front leg.
